degster: "I won NAVI once, but you have to win them 9 out of 10 times"

OG player Abdul "degster" Gasanov has spoken about adaptation to the new team and plans for the future in a video on his YouTube channel. The Russian believes that now when he is not a stand-in but a full-fledged member of the squad, it is important to work on consistency.

As an example of the results of such work, the sniper cited the confrontation against NAVI, who OG defeated at BLAST Premier Spring Final 2021. He is sure that if everything is done properly, his team will regularly beat such strong opponents.

I don’t build high expectations, because stand-in is a stand-in role, you came here and you understand that there's nothing here to do except we just need to win the tournament all together or at least show the highest result we can show but now I’m on the team and I know we have some work to do to win against these teams for a long period of time. Not just once, but to keep the distance, it is very important, because, yeah, I won NAVI once, but you have to win them 9 out of 10 times at the very least. And do it in very important tournaments. It's a way more important result than winning top team once.

Gasanov also shared his expectations for the upcoming tournaments, at which OG will start the new competitive season.

RMR tournament qualifiers is the main tournament for us at the moment. We must start with the open qualifiers and then we’re playing the BLAST in Copenhagen, a super cool tournament, and I really wanted to play there. The opening round is us vs Vitality, NIP vs Astralis. As I know, Vitality’s trying to replace misutaaa, which means something is wrong in the team. But anyway, the team is really strong, with 3 or 4 times Major-winning players, and the match is not going to be easy for us. First of all, after qualifiers we need to get ready for the match with Vitality. Besides us there are NIP and Astralis, which are pretty easy to win, they are no FaZe or NAVI, but we already played with NAVI and even won, despite the fact I was a stand-in.

I think the most important thing is to get prepared well for the BLAST and our opponents, even though we don’t have enough time. We have to understand how to cooperate to win the teams, we did it before. The thing to remember is how we did it despite feeling nervous about not having enough time. It’s not my first open qualifiers, as you know, I played the Major semi-final recently, before that we worked hard to get a slot in RMR-tournament and then we went to the semi-final. I don’t think it’s going to be hard, especially because most of the strongest teams are already invited.

The first open qualifier for the upcoming European RMR tournament will kick off on August 15. Meanwhile, on August 13, OG will take part in an exhibition one-day event, which will be hosted by the club's sponsor, SteelSeries.
